MH3261-900Y Ferrite Bead 90 Ohm 1206 Equivalent & Substitute Parts
Part Overview
The MH3261-900Y is a 1206 surface mount ferrite bead manufactured by Bourns Inc., rated at 90 Ohms impedance at 100 MHz with a maximum current rating of 3A and 40mOhm DC resistance. This component is designed for power and signal line filtering applications across a temperature range of -55°C to 125°C. The part is currently listed as obsolete, making identification of equivalent and substitute components essential for ongoing design support and procurement.

Key Parameters
| Parameter | MH3261-900Y |
|---|---|
| Impedance @ 100 MHz | 90 Ohms |
| Current Rating (Max) | 3A |
| DC Resistance (Max) | 40mOhm |
| Package / Case | 1206 (3216 Metric) |
| Operating Temperature | -55°C ~ 125°C |
| Mounting Type | Surface Mount |
| RoHS Status | ROHS3 Compliant |
| Product Status | Obsolete |
Substitute Part Grouping Explanation
Substitution of the MH3261-900Y is determined by the following critical parameters: package type (1206/3216 Metric), surface mount configuration, impedance value at 100 MHz, current rating capability, DC resistance, operating temperature range, and regulatory compliance (RoHS3). Substitute parts are grouped into two categories based on impedance matching:
Category 1: Direct Impedance Match (90 Ohms @ 100 MHz)
- MI1206K900R-10 (Laird-Signal Integrity Products): Matches impedance specification but with reduced current rating (1.5A vs 3A) and higher DC resistance (80mOhm vs 40mOhm).
Category 2: Parametric Equivalents (80-100 Ohms @ 100 MHz)
- Parts with 80 Ohm impedance: 742792115, 74279215, 742792150, BBPY00321611800Y00, BBUP00321611800Y00
- Parts with 100 Ohm impedance: BBPY00321611101Y00, BBUP00321611101Y00, CZP2BPTTE101P, FBH321611T-101Y-S
These alternatives maintain the same package footprint and operating temperature range while offering variations in current handling and DC resistance characteristics suitable for different circuit requirements.
Parameter Comparison
| Part Number | Manufacturer | Impedance @ 100 MHz | Current Rating (Max) | DC Resistance (Max) | Operating Temperature | Product Status | RoHS Status |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| MH3261-900Y | Bourns Inc. | 90 Ohms | 3A | 40mOhm | -55°C ~ 125°C | Obsolete | ROHS3 Compliant |
| MI1206K900R-10 | Laird-Signal Integrity Products | 90 Ohms | 1.5A | 80mOhm | -40°C ~ 125°C | Active | ROHS3 Compliant |
| 742792115 | Würth Elektronik | 80 Ohms | 4A | 25mOhm | -55°C ~ 125°C | Obsolete | ROHS3 Compliant |
| 74279215 | Würth Elektronik | 80 Ohms | 3A | 30mOhm | -55°C ~ 125°C | Active | ROHS3 Compliant |
| 742792150 | Würth Elektronik | 80 Ohms | 4A | 20mOhm | -55°C ~ 125°C | Active | ROHS3 Compliant |
| BBPY00321611101Y00 | Pulse Electronics | 100 Ohms | 3A | 30mOhm | -55°C ~ 125°C | Active | ROHS3 Compliant |
| BBPY00321611800Y00 | Pulse Electronics | 80 Ohms | 3A | 25mOhm | -55°C ~ 125°C | Active | ROHS3 Compliant |
| BBUP00321611101Y00 | Pulse Electronics | 100 Ohms | 6A | 12mOhm | -55°C ~ 125°C | Active | ROHS3 Compliant |
| BBUP00321611800Y00 | Pulse Electronics | 80 Ohms | 6A | 12mOhm | -55°C ~ 125°C | Active | ROHS3 Compliant |
| CZP2BPTTE101P | KOA Speer Electronics, Inc. | 100 Ohms | 3A | 30mOhm | -55°C ~ 125°C | Active | ROHS3 Compliant |
| FBH321611T-101Y-S | Cal-Chip Electronics, Inc. | 100 Ohms | 3A | 40mOhm | -55°C ~ 125°C | Active | RoHS Compliant |
Engineering Selection Recommendations
For direct replacement of the MH3261-900Y, MI1206K900R-10 provides the closest impedance match at 90 Ohms. However, this part operates at a reduced maximum current of 1.5A compared to the original 3A specification and exhibits higher DC resistance. This substitute is suitable only for applications where the lower current rating and higher resistance are acceptable.
For applications requiring the full 3A current capability with improved DC resistance characteristics, the Würth Elektronik 74279215 (80 Ohms, 3A, 30mOhm) is an active product offering equivalent performance with lower insertion loss. The Pulse Electronics BBUP00321611800Y00 (80 Ohms, 6A, 12mOhm) provides superior current handling and minimal DC resistance, suitable for demanding power line applications.
For 100 Ohm impedance requirements, the FBH321611T-101Y-S (Cal-Chip Electronics) matches the original DC resistance specification of 40mOhm while maintaining 3A current rating and active product status. The Pulse Electronics BBUP00321611101Y00 offers enhanced current capacity (6A) with significantly reduced DC resistance (12mOhm) for high-performance filtering.
All recommended substitutes maintain ROHS3 compliance, 1206 package footprint, and -55°C to 125°C operating temperature range. Selection should be based on specific circuit impedance requirements and current handling needs.
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)
Q: Can MI1206K900R-10 be used as a direct replacement for MH3261-900Y?
A: MI1206K900R-10 matches the 90 Ohm impedance specification but has a maximum current rating of 1.5A versus the original 3A. It is suitable only if your circuit operates below 1.5A. Additionally, the operating temperature minimum is -40°C instead of -55°C, which may be a limitation in extreme cold environments.
Q: What is the difference between 80 Ohm and 100 Ohm ferrite beads for this application?
A: Impedance value determines the frequency-dependent attenuation characteristics. An 80 Ohm bead provides slightly less impedance than the original 90 Ohm specification, while a 100 Ohm bead provides slightly more. Selection depends on your circuit's filtering requirements at the target frequency. Both are compatible with the 1206 package footprint.
Q: Why do some substitutes have lower DC resistance than the original?
A: DC resistance (DCR) represents the resistive losses in the ferrite material. Lower DCR values (such as 12mOhm in BBUP series) indicate improved efficiency and reduced power dissipation, particularly beneficial in high-current applications. Higher DCR values (40mOhm) are acceptable in low-current signal filtering applications.
Q: Are all listed substitutes RoHS3 compliant?
A: All substitutes listed are RoHS3 compliant except FBH321611T-101Y-S, which is RoHS compliant. Verify your procurement requirements for regulatory compliance before selection.
Q: Can I use a 6A-rated ferrite bead in place of a 3A-rated component?
A: Yes. A higher current rating indicates the component can safely handle greater current without exceeding thermal limits. Parts such as BBUP00321611800Y00 (6A) and BBUP00321611101Y00 (6A) are suitable for applications originally designed for 3A components, provided impedance and package requirements are met.
Q: What is the significance of the 1206 (3216 Metric) package designation?
A: This indicates the physical footprint dimensions: 0.126" L × 0.063" W (3.20mm × 1.60mm). All listed substitutes use this identical package, ensuring direct PCB footprint compatibility without layout modifications.
